NVIDIA is looking for a Director to lead our Global Interconnect System Sourcing Team including Connector, Cable & Optics for the products across multiple business units. NVIDIA has continuously reinvented itself over two decades. Our invention of the GPU in 1999 sparked the growth of the PC gaming market, redefined modern computer graphics, and revolutionized parallel computing — with the GPU acting as the brains of computers, robots, and self-driving cars that can perceive and understand the world. Today, we are increasingly known as “the AI computing company.” We're looking to grow our company and build our teams with the smartest people in the world. What you’ll be doing:

This Interconnect System Group Director will be a transformative leader who can develop, deliver, and implement comprehensive commodity strategies. You are a recognized leader, with executive contacts throughout the industry, and have experience leading sourcing teams for various business segments. As a global commodity management professional, you demonstrate strong analytical skills to guide decisions, are highly collaborative and have both business acumen and technical experience in the Connector, Cable and Optics industry. You will have successfully transformed commodity management teams, led supplier engagements, and have provided outstanding value to other operations and engineering teams.

  • Build a strategy and vision for NVIDIA's Connector, Cable, and Optics commodity management team. Incorporate internal and external ideas to establish a robust sourcing team.

  • Collaborate with and build positive and productive relationships with Suppliers and internal functions to deliver top and bottom-line results

  • Collaborate with and influence leaders across various cross-functional organizations, collaborators, suppliers on a regular basis; coordinate engagement with the entire ecosystem.

  • Drive multi-year strategies and partnership engagement to support NVIDIA's fast growth business requirements

  • Develop goals and objectives for the Connector, Cable and Optics commodity team that supports business needs. Provide ongoing development, coaching and performance management to the team and ensure a high level of performance.

What we need to see:

  • 15+ overall years of strategic sourcing and high-tech industry experience or related field, 8+ years of management experience

  • Extensive global sourcing leadership experience building and engaging global Connector, Cable and Optic partners

  • BA / BS degree (Masters preferred), or equivalent experience

  • Outstanding negotiation skills in executive supplier management

  • Excellent communications and influencing skills working with engineering, finance, business units, and other supply chain functions

  • High degree of integrity, initiative, and attention to detail

About The Company

Since its founding in 1993, NVIDIA (NASDAQ: NVDA) has been a pioneer in accelerated computing. The company’s invention of the GPU in 1999 sparked the growth of the PC gaming market, redefined computer graphics, ignited the era of modern AI and is fueling the creation of the metaverse. NVIDIA is now a full-stack computing company with data-center-scale offerings that are reshaping industry.
